Prevalence of Engine Issues in Vehicles

Engine problems are among the most common issues vehicle owners face. Understanding these issues can help mitigate long-term damage and save on costly repairs. Here are the top five engine problems that you should be aware of.

1. Overheating

Overheating can be caused by various factors, including low coolant levels or a malfunctioning thermostat. Regularly checking coolant levels and having the cooling system inspected can prevent overheating.

2. Oil Leaks

Oil leaks can lead to engine damage if left unaddressed. Regular inspections and immediate repairs are crucial. Checking oil levels and ensuring seals and gaskets are in good condition can prevent leaks.

3. Engine Misfiring

Misfiring can indicate spark plug issues or fuel supply problems. Regular maintenance, including spark plug replacements, can prevent misfiring and maintain performance.

4. Excessive Exhaust Smoke

Smoke can indicate several issues, including burning oil or coolant leaks. Diagnosing the problem early can prevent further damage and costly repairs.

5. Check Engine Light

If the check engine light illuminates, it’s essential to perform diagnostics to determine the cause. Ignoring this warning can lead to more severe issues.
